Archaeologists Found a Celtic Prince’s Chariot Grave. The Prince Is Missing.
Archaeologists uncovered an extraordinary 2,500-year-old chariot grave in Germany, a significant Iron Age find brimming with treasures like gold ornaments and intricate tools. However, the most puzzling aspect is the absence of the Celtic prince it was believed to house. This discovery sheds light on the wealth and culture of the time but leaves historians puzzled about the prince's fate, prompting further investigation into his mysterious disappearance. Such findings are crucial for understanding ancient Celtic societies and their burial customs.
